This report analyzed 2 schools in the New England Region to see which ones offered the best value doctor's degree programs for HR students. The goal was to highlight schools with more affordable prices than others offering similar quality experiences.

Our ranking of value is based on the quality of a program as defined in our per sticker price dollar.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.

In our regional and nationwide rankings, out-of-state tution and fees are used in our calculations.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.

#1

Boston College

Chestnut Hill, MA

Our analysis found Boston College to be the best value school for human resource management students who want to pursue a doctor’s degree in the New England Region . Boston College is a fairly large private not-for-profit school located in the small city of Chestnut Hill.

Boston College graduate students pay an average of $32,722 in tuition and fees each year.

#2

Harvard University

Cambridge, MA

Out of the 2 schools in the New England Region that were part of this year’s ranking, Harvard University landed the # 2 spot on the list. Located in the medium-sized city of Cambridge, Harvard is a private not-for-profit school with a very large student population.

Harvard graduate students pay an average of $52,170 in tuition and fees each year.

Harvard also made our Best Human Resource Management Doctor’s Degree Schools in the New England Region list, coming in at #2.
